Ignore the memes for a second, some industries literally ONLY exist in those cities though.

Like film and tv, if you dont live in london, NY or LA it will be 5 times harder to get anywhere in your career. Or banking. Or to a lesser extent music and the arts.

For an entrepreneur too, the social networks and infrastructure and the markets are bigger and better in those cities. recruiting is easy, advertising is easier.
